
About us
Our mission is to empower sewing and design professionals to succeed in business.
Our meetings are focused on topics that are skill-oriented and are generally geared towards those who run sewing and design businesses. You are more than welcome to join us if you don't have a business or if you are thinking of starting a business and want to learn more about the process.
